A running track

Providing a free track would help focus residents of Littlemoor on wellbeing and fitness - keeping residents healthy and saving on resources such as medical centres and dependency on medications. The benefits of fitness and exercise are well known and are publicised especially the positive impact on mental health.

Weymouth has a very active running community with over 400 people turning up for Parkrun every Saturday as well as hosting many events such as Iron Man and Weymouth half etc and hundreds of people run along the esplanade every day and lots of clubs in the area who organise C25K for free.

However the only track (which is beneficial for starters/recovery/ clubs) is the makeshift one by the park and ride which is not felt safe for single runners at night.

An organised lit track (like Yeovil) would provide a safe space for people to run especially in the winter months and could even be multi use as a pitch for other sports.

I think we need should use the money for a positive addition to Littlemoor, get residents out in the fresh air and into sports and fitness. Running is a low cost sport to take up and starts with one step.
